## Catalogue Import: Tuning

The Fennick importer ingests MARC-style records from partner libraries in nightly batches. Throughput is bounded by the dedup pass, which holds a normalized-title index in memory; batch size therefore trades RAM against restart cost on failure. Retry limits are deliberately low — bad records go to the quarantine table, not back into the queue. Parallelism above four workers gains nothing on the Drayhall cluster. The constants we ship with are below.

tuning constants:
TIERS = {
    "silys": 464,
    "beldor": 976,
    "fraion": 68,
    "fenath": 281,
    "novvan": 333,
    "zordor": 202,
    "kasix": 219,
}

MEMO TO: Branch Managers — from Hollis at HQ

Quick heads-up: the Lanternbridge rollout is slipping again, this time by about six weeks. The integration work with the old Quillmark ledger system turned out messier than anyone expected, and the vendor swap didn't help. Keep running your current processes in the meantime — don't start migrating records early, please. We'll send revised training dates once the new timeline is locked. Sorry for the churn. For the bigger picture, see the confidential note on our plans just below.

board note of baguf-fafog: Kasixox Foods plans to lower the Drueth list price by 48 percent in March.

**Ticket: Stale tax rates served from lookup cache**

The Ledgerbee tax-rate cache isn't invalidating after the quarterly rate import, so checkout shows last quarter's rates for a few regions. Workaround: flush the cache manually post-import. On-call: please confirm the fix in staging. The build token for the patched deploy follows below.

pipeline stamp: htk9_ce63042d9